Uzbekistan and Turkmenistan have switched to electronic registration of international road transport based on TIR Carnet books, newshub.uz reports with reference to the press service of the Ministry of Transport of Uzbekistan.

The first international transportation under the digital transport program between the two countries has already started. The system will allow to carry out the clearance process accurately and in a short time when transporting goods across the customs border.

An electronic version of the TIR system has previously been introduced in Kazakhstan, Tajikistan and Kyrgyzstan. The connection of Turkmenistan will be of great importance for the countries of Central Asia in applying a paperless regime in international cargo transportation.

The passage of goods across the border of the two countries will be regulated by the TIR system, which operates on the basis of the Customs Convention on the International Carriage of Goods using a TIR Carnet. This system allows to significantly simplify and speed up the customs clearance procedure.
